Transaction fdcfb4e5014d51c3b21bbf74aed863ae8b2b391fc14cb6419256561bce76cff9

1 Input
2 Outputs
  • fdcfb4e5014d51c3b21bbf74aed863ae8b2b391fc14cb6419256561bce76cff9:0
  • value  1094330236
    address  14nyP56ieMrWUdRWB3VY7xbZkFbKcYYkat
  • fdcfb4e5014d51c3b21bbf74aed863ae8b2b391fc14cb6419256561bce76cff9:1
  • value  32670302
    address  12jy7VuxqhzhtwNo7aYoXXx3wGQUtL8k7E